DEDECMS里面DEDE函数解析

下面来解说下DEDECMS织梦CMS模板里面的函数说明

在文件include/inc_function.php里面

GetCurUrl()
获贴切前的脚本的URL

 

GetAlabNum($str)
把字符串里的全角数字转为半角数字(会把非数字种类字符剔除)

  

Text2Html($txt)
文本转HTML

  

Html2Text($str)
获得HTML里的文本

  

function ClearHtml($str)
打扫HTML符号

  

cnw_left($str,$len)
中文截取把双字节字符也看作一个字符

  

cn_substr($str,$slen,$startdd=0)
中文截取2,单字节截取形式

  

GetMkTime($dtime)
把日期时间格式转换为Linux时间截,对于不能分辨的日期时间格式,会归来time()

  

SubDay($ntime,$stime)
归来收缩一天的Linux时间截

  

AddDay($ntime,$aday)
归来添置一天的Linux时间截

  

GetDateTimeMk($mktime)
从指定的Linux时间截转换 0000-00-00 00:00:00 样式的日期时间

  

GetDateMk($mktime)
从指定的Linux时间截转换为 0000-00-00 样式的日期时间

  

GetIP()
获得客户部IP

  

GetPinyin($str,$ishead=0,$isclose=1) 
获得一串中文字符的拼音 ishead=0 时,输出全拼音 ishead=1时,输出拼音首字母

  

ShowMsg($msg,$gourl,$onlymsg=0,$limittime=0)
揭示Dedecms提醒消息,其中当onlymsg=1时,不跳转,仅揭示alert提醒

  

dd2char($dd)
把相称法定的数字转为字母(相称a-zA-Z Ascii码的数字转换为字母,不相称则不变)

  

PutCookie($key,$value,$kptime,$pa="/")
按默认参数设置一个Cookie(dede的cookie是穿越加密的,定然用GetCookie获得值,以防止用户模仿登录)

  

DropCookie($key)
使Cookie失效

  

function GetCookie($key)
获得一个cookie值

  

function GetCkVdValue()
获得检讨码的session值

  

FtpMkdir($truepath,$mmode,$isMkdir=true)
用FTP创立一个目录

  

FtpChmod($truepath,$mmode)
用FTP改换一个目录的权限

  

OpenFtp()
敞开FTP连接

  

CloseFtp()
关闭FTP连接

  

TestStringSafe(&$uid)
用户ID和密码或其它字符串平安性测验,归来true或false 

  

htmlEncode($string)
过滤HTML代码

  

function AjaxHead()
发送一个ajax头

  

sendmail($email, $mailtitle, $mailbody, $headers)
邮件发送函数

  

highlight($string,sidchina.com $words, $hrefs='')
加亮一段HTML里的某些词汇

  

原文地址:https://www.cnblogs.com/xcxc/p/3603868.html